Transaction 504afbdf966583fd70224d46e94abb732c76202e73c21ef12522dd490fd6e3a7

1 Input
2 Outputs
  • 504afbdf966583fd70224d46e94abb732c76202e73c21ef12522dd490fd6e3a7:0
  • value  2265300
    address  3K97dpRySGdyttSv5cNAXKbRBKWNwynY5P
  • 504afbdf966583fd70224d46e94abb732c76202e73c21ef12522dd490fd6e3a7:1
  • value  15102997
    address  1PmEd6FWT7vMgmYZTVa5SXQX3smLwnJQNF